Late Black Stars player Raphael Dwamena will be laid to rest on Friday, February 16, 2024.
The former Ghana striker was pronounced dead on Saturday, November 11,2023 after collapsing on a football pitch during a League match in Albania.
The Egnatia player suffered a heart attack during a League match between Egnatia and Partizani.
The 28-year-old ex-national star collapsed on the field in the 24th minute of the league game and passed away minutes later at the Kavaja hospital.

The former Red Bull Academy player represented Ghana 9 times and scored two goals.
The Ghana Football Association has accepted to assist the family with the final funeral rites for the ex- national star.
The funeral and burial service will be held at the Adjiriganor Astro Turf in Accra.
